Τι είναι ένας παραμετροποιημένος κατασκευαστής;

Τι είναι ένας παραμετροποιημένος κατασκευαστής;
Τι είναι ένας παραμετροποιημένος κατασκευαστής;
Anonim

Οι παραμετροποιημένοι κατασκευαστές είναι οι κατασκευαστές που έχουν συγκεκριμένο αριθμό ορισμάτων προς διαβίβαση. Ο σκοπός ενός παραμετροποιημένου κατασκευαστή είναι να εκχωρήσει συγκεκριμένες τιμές που επιθυμεί ο χρήστης στις μεταβλητές εμφάνισης διαφορετικών αντικειμένων. Ένας παραμετροποιημένος κατασκευαστής γράφεται ρητά από έναν προγραμματιστή.

Τι είναι παραμετροποιημένος κατασκευαστής με παράδειγμα;

Παραμετροποιημένος Κατασκευαστής – Ένας κατασκευαστής ονομάζεται Παραμετροποιημένος Κατασκευαστής όταν δέχεται συγκεκριμένο αριθμό παραμέτρων. Για την προετοιμασία μελών δεδομένων μιας κλάσης με διακριτές τιμές. Στο παραπάνω παράδειγμα, περνάμε μια συμβολοσειρά και έναν ακέραιο στο αντικείμενο.

Τι είναι ο παραμετροποιημένος κατασκευαστής στο OOP;

Οι κατασκευαστές που μπορούν να λάβουν τουλάχιστον ένα όρισμα ορίζονται ως παραμετροποιημένοι κατασκευαστές. Όταν ένα αντικείμενο δηλώνεται σε έναν παραμετροποιημένο κατασκευαστή, οι αρχικές τιμές πρέπει να περάσουν ως ορίσματα στη συνάρτηση του κατασκευαστή.

Πότε θα χρησιμοποιούσατε έναν παραμετροποιημένο κατασκευαστή;

Όπως σε κάθε αντικειμενοστραφή γλώσσα, χρησιμοποιείται μια μέθοδος κατασκευής για την κατανομή και την προετοιμασία της μνήμης για ένα αντικείμενο. Έχοντας αυτό υπόψη, χρησιμοποιείται μια παραμετροποιημένη μέθοδος κατασκευής για τον ορισμό των ιδιοτήτων του αντικειμένου σε συγκεκριμένη τιμή, ενώ η προεπιλογή δεν θα ορίσει καμία τιμή σε καμία από τις ιδιότητες.

Τι είναι ο παραμετροποιημένος κατασκευαστής στην Java;

Ένας κατασκευαστής που έχει παραμέτρους είναι γνωστός ως παραμετροποιημένος κατασκευαστής. Αν εμείςΘέλουμε να αρχικοποιήσουμε τα πεδία της κλάσης με τις δικές μας τιμές και στη συνέχεια να χρησιμοποιήσουμε έναν παραμετροποιημένο κατασκευαστή. Παράδειγμα: Java.

Συνιστάται: